http://rasppiprojekte.blogger.de/stories/2442344/
0. Bild

1. Projektstatus
erledigt
2. Teilprojekte
3. Hardware
MMA7455 x,y-Achse funktionieren
4. Pin-Belegung
pin 1 - 3v3
pin 3 - SDA
pin 5 - SDL
GND
5. Code
11 (py, 2 KB)
6. Anmerkung
Hilfreiches Video
http://www.youtube.com/watch?v=OYXXvaypUKQ
Quellcode hier:
http://www.forum-raspberrypi.de/Thread-beschleunigungssensor-mma7455-ueber-i2c-auslesen
.
thomasschwerin am 24. Oktober 14
|
Permalink
|
0 Kommentare
|
kommentieren
http://rasppiprojekte.blogger.de/stories/2442344/
0. Bild
1. Projektstatus
2. Teilprojekte
3. Hardware
4. Pin-Belegung
5. Code
10_plus (txt, 2 KB)
Class servo erstellen
+|--- 99_headborg
++++|--- dbzugriff
++++|--- servo
6. Anmerkung
-1000 Ohm Wiederstand stütz Servo vor zu starken Signalen
http://razzpisampler.oreilly.com/ch05.html
-Beispiel für das Servo-Modul
http://raspi.tv/2013/how-to-use-soft-pwm-in-rpi-gpio-pt-2-led-dimming-and-motor-speed-control
.
thomasschwerin am 23. Oktober 14
|
Permalink
|
0 Kommentare
|
kommentieren
http://rasppiprojekte.blogger.de/stories/2442344/
0. Bild
1. Projektstatus
2. Teilprojekte
3. Hardware
4. Pin-Belegung
5. Code
-create table headborg(id int primary key auto_increment, servo varchar(25), links decimal(5,1), rechts decimal(5,1), neutral decimal(5,1), position decimal(5,1), pin int, pause decimal(5,2));
-insert into headborg(servo) values ('l_03');
-select * from headborg;
1. Verzeichnis anlegen "99_headborg" mkdir 99_headborg
2. Verzeichnis anlegen „dbzugriff"
3. DB_Zugriff.py im Verzeichnis „dbzugriff" ablegen
4. __init__.py im Verzeichnis „dbzugriff" ablegen
5. headborg.py im Verzeichnis "99_headborg" ablegen
# -----------------------
# Select * from headborg where servo = 'l_03';
# Insert into headborg (servo,links,rechts,neutral,position) values('l_01',7.5,12.5,2.5,5.0,15,0.015);
# Update headborg SET links=7.5,rechts=12.5,neutral=2.5,position=5.0 where servo='l_01';
# Delete from headborg where servo = 'l_01';
---Batch-------------
#!/bin/bash
clear
echo "Update, World."
-----------------------
Speichern unter dem Namen "update"
Rechte vergeben: chmod 755 update
Aufruf mit ./update
shell> mysql -h localhost -u pi -pSeCrEt headborg < select.sql
select.sql
select * from headboarg;
09 (rtf, 1 KB)
6. Anmerkung
sehr hilfreich
http://zetcode.com/db/mysqlpython/
.
thomasschwerin am 17. Oktober 14
|
Permalink
|
0 Kommentare
|
kommentieren